Time in proof-of-stake Ethereum is divided into slots (12 seconds) and epochs (32 slots). One validator is randomly selected to be a block proposer in each slot. This validator is liable for creating a model new block and sending it out to other nodes on the community.

When Ethereum launched, proof-of-stake nonetheless needed a lot of analysis and growth before it could be trusted to safe Ethereum. Proof-of-work was a much less complicated mechanism that had already been confirmed by Bitcoin, meaning core developers could implement it right away to get Ethereum launched. It took an extra eight years to develop proof-of-stake to the purpose the place it might be applied. In a typical PoS system, validators take turns proposing and validating blocks. The selection course of is commonly randomized, making certain fairness and stopping any single entity from dominating the consensus process.

Validators are also required to put up a stake, which serves as collateral that may be forfeited in the event that they act maliciously or fail to fulfill their duties. The Beacon Chain acted as a sandbox for proof-of-stake testing, because it was a stay blockchain implementing the proof-of-stake consensus logic however without touching real Ethereum transactions – effectively simply coming to consensus on itself. Once this had been stable and bug-free for a adequate time, the Beacon Chain was “merged” with Ethereum Mainnet. This all contributed to taming the complexity of proof-of-stake to the purpose that the chance of unintended consequences or client bugs was very low.
